NASA’s Shared Services Center (NSSC) issued RFQ 80NSSC26922577Q requesting fabrication and delivery of Upper Elevon Heater Carriage components per NASA AFRC design drawings. The contract is a Small Business set-aside (NAICS 333998) and requires fabrication of multiple specific parts (listed in the SOW) with delivery completed within 12 weeks of award. Place of performance is Edwards, CA, and proposals are due Jan 21, 2026 at 5:00 p.m. EST.

AvailableNASA (via its Shared Services Center) solicits fabrication services for Upper Elevon Heater Carriage components to support a ground test at NASA Armstrong Flight Research Center. The work includes fabrication of multiple component types across 20 drawing sets, delivery within a maximum of 12 weeks after award, submission of a manufacturing process plan and quality plan, and three references from the last three years. The procurement is a Small Business set-aside and will be evaluated on a best-value approach (price, fabrication duration, past performance, technical acceptability).
